Melbourne's five bedroom trophy home Zermatt, in Surrey Hills, has sold for $5,655,000 at private auction.

The home, 16 Tower St Surrey Hills, was built in 1914 and features northern views to the ranges, a resort-style tennis court and pool over 1515sqm.

It also features two study areas, a games room with cathedral ceilings, butler's pantry and rooftop terrace.

It sold through Kay & Burton's Judy Balloch and Scott Patterson.
